Step 2: The "Day in the Life" Interrogation
If you want to be a UX Designer, don't look at the salary package. Look at the daily grind. Find someone who is doing that exact job and ask them the ugly questions:
What is the most boring part of your day?
How often do you work on weekends?
What is the burnout rate?
If you can handle the worst parts of the job, that’s your green light.
